Transaction 5279d105eeb2cb2d5dfed33571fcbf16bff13a02470873cd0a97ff104e70d49e
1 Input
1 Output
-
5279d105eeb2cb2d5dfed33571fcbf16bff13a02470873cd0a97ff104e70d49e:0
- value
- 1538561
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d26ffa01e7c47fe137a0456fa06da364720b1997 OP_EQUAL
- address
- 3Lshy6eLPK8f7ef8s8Hm7iZgq758K8MMbV